# SaddleLLM

SaddleLLM 是一个面向本地研究与工程实验的大语言模型训练工具包，覆盖数据检查、训练规划、SFT、偏好优化、RL/GRPO、评估、蒸馏、量化和部署等流程。

当前版本：`2.31`

> 建议先运行环境检查、数据检查和 dry-run，再启动真实训练。仓库包含稳定主线和实验性模块，并非所有功能都适合直接用于大规模生产训练。

## 主要能力

- 训练工厂：领域工作区、Recipe、Orchestrator 和实验产物管理
- 数据处理：SFT、DPO、ORPO、KTO、RL/GRPO 和 VLA 数据检查与规范化
- 后训练：Full Fine-tuning、LoRA、QLoRA、SFT 和 preference optimization
- 强化学习：native GRPO、可验证奖励和 source-frontier profiling
- 模型实验：Dense、GQA、MoE、MLA、MTP 和 Long Context blueprint
- 评估与诊断：Benchmark、训练报告、环境检查和 smoke test
- 模型工程：蒸馏、量化、剪枝、部署和安全生成
- 多模态/VLA：提供实验性的数据、模型和训练入口

## 最短上手流程

### 1. 检查环境

```powershell
saddle-llm doctor
saddle-llm doctor --output build\doctor_report.json
```

### 2. 运行内置 smoke test

```powershell
saddle-llm smoke-test --in-process --skip-doctor `
  --work-dir build\smoke_e2e_fast
```

只检查 fixture、数据和配置，不执行训练：

```powershell
saddle-llm smoke-test --skip-training
```

### 3. 检查训练数据

```powershell
saddle-llm inspect-data data\sft.jsonl --task sft
saddle-llm inspect-data data\preference.jsonl --task dpo
saddle-llm inspect-data data\rl.jsonl --task grpo
```

### 4. 检查并编译配置

仓库提供了以下模板：

- `configs/sft_lora.yaml`
- `configs/dpo_qlora.yaml`
- `configs/preflight.yaml`
- `configs/vla_sft.yaml`
- `configs/mopd_sft.yaml`

```powershell
saddle-llm validate-config configs\sft_lora.yaml
saddle-llm plan configs\sft_lora.yaml
```

### 5. Dry-run 和训练

```powershell
saddle-llm train configs\sft_lora.yaml --dry-run
saddle-llm train configs\sft_lora.yaml
```

训练失败时显示完整 traceback：

```powershell
saddle-llm train configs\sft_lora.yaml --debug
```

推荐顺序：

```text
doctor
  -> smoke-test --skip-training
  -> inspect-data
  -> validate-config
  -> preflight
  -> plan
  -> train --dry-run
  -> train
  -> report
```

## Python API

### 创建领域训练工厂

```python
from saddle_llm import LLMTrainingFactory

factory = LLMTrainingFactory.for_domain(
    domain="general",
    root_dir="./llm_factory",
    base_model="Qwen/Qwen2.5-7B-Instruct",
    max_seq_length=2048,
    global_batch_size=16,
    num_gpus=1,
    gpu_memory_gb=24.0,
)

factory.create_workspace()
factory.save_plan()
```

### 创建 SFT 计划

```python
plan = factory.create_post_training_plan(
    data_path="./data/sft.jsonl",
    stage="sft",
    method="qlora",
    max_steps=1000,
    save=True,
)
```

该调用会生成规范化数据、Recipe、Orchestrator config 和训练计划。

### 创建 DPO 计划

```python
plan = factory.create_post_training_plan(
    data_path="./data/preference.jsonl",
    stage="dpo",
    method="qlora",
    beta=0.1,
    save=True,
)
```

### 执行 Orchestrator 配置

```python
from saddle_llm import TrainingOrchestrator

orchestrator = TrainingOrchestrator.from_yaml("./configs/train.yaml")
result = orchestrator.run()
```

## 数据格式

### SFT：Alpaca JSONL

```json
{"instruction":"总结下面的政策意见","input":"...","output":"..."}
```

### SFT：Messages JSONL

```json
{"messages":[{"role":"user","content":"..."},{"role":"assistant","content":"..."}]}
```

### Preference：DPO/ORPO JSONL

```json
{"prompt":"...","chosen":"更好的回答","rejected":"较差的回答"}
```

在加载模型前运行 `inspect-data`，可以检查字段、重复样本、长度和 `chosen == rejected` 等问题。

## 当前边界

- CLI、数据检查、Recipe、Orchestrator 和 smoke-test 是推荐入口。
- native GRPO 适合小规模研究和链路验证；大规模实验应进一步验证吞吐、分布式和 checkpoint 行为。
- VLA、多模态、部分高级架构及部分第三方后端仍属于实验性能力。
